IN A TEMPERED MANNER Meaning and Definition

  1. "In a tempered manner" refers to the act of behaving or performing in a way that is characterized by moderation, self-restraint, calmness, and control. It suggests displaying a balanced and measured approach in one's actions, emotions, or interactions with others.

    The term "tempered" itself implies the act of tempering or adjusting something to achieve the ideal condition or state. When applied to manner or behavior, it signifies exercising restraint and not giving in to extremes. It involves avoiding excessive reactions, impulsivity, or erratic behavior, and instead, adopting a more composed and thoughtful approach.

    Acting in a tempered manner entails being mindful of one's words, expressions, and reactions, considering the potential impact they may have on others. It involves keeping calm and collected during challenging or stressful situations, as opposed to getting overwhelmed or losing control. Maintaining a tempered manner can help create an atmosphere of stability, rationality, and fairness.

    In a personal context, it implies practicing self-control, avoiding extremes of anger, excitement, or other emotions, and instead, striving for equilibrium. It encompasses being level-headed, patient, and having the ability to make rational decisions without being influenced by emotions.

    Overall, conducting oneself "in a tempered manner" entails exhibiting moderation, self-control, and composure, thereby fostering harmonious relationships and facilitating wise decision-making.
